Solution for What is 71 percent of 165275:

71 percent *165275 =

(71:100)*165275 =

(71*165275):100 =

11734525:100 = 117345.25

Now we have: 71 percent of 165275 = 117345.25

Question: What is 71 percent of 165275?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: Our output value is 165275.

Step 2: We represent the unknown value with {x}.

Step 3: From step 1 above,{165275}={100\%}.

Step 4: Similarly, {x}={71\%}.

Step 5: This results in a pair of simple equations:

{165275}={100\%}(1).

{x}={71\%}(2).

Step 6: By dividing equation 1 by equation 2 and noting that both the RHS (right hand side) of both
equations have the same unit (%); we have

\frac{165275}{x}=\frac{100\%}{71\%}

Step 7: Again, the reciprocal of both sides gives

\frac{x}{165275}=\frac{71}{100}

\Rightarrow{x} = {117345.25}

Therefore, {71\%} of {165275} is {117345.25}
